A custom crane is a lifting and handling solution tailored to meet specific operational requirements. It is designed, engineered, and manufactured to address unique challenges and optimise efficiency within a particular industry or application.

Custom cranes are designed to precisely match your operational needs, ensuring maximum efficiency and safety. They are ideal when standard cranes do not adequately address your unique lifting or handling requirements.
Custom cranes find applications across various industries, including manufacturing, construction, energy, automotive, and more. Any industry with specialised lifting or material handling needs can benefit from a tailored crane solution.

The timeline for designing and manufacturing a custom crane varies based on complexity, size, and specific requirements. An expected lead-time will be given with your quotation but in many cases, it is only five or six weeks and comparable with the standard crane ranges.
